Service Description

In this 3-week course, you'll learn the magic of acrylic pouring. Each class, held weekly for 2 hours, will start with a demonstration, followed by guided practice. We'll begin with the basics: colour theory, and creating acrylic pouring medium. By the end of the course, you will make 4 artworks on 4 canvasses. First class: 1 small canvas Second class: 1 large canvas Third class: 2 small canvases Techniques: Dirt Pour, Travelling Cup, Ribbon Pour, Dutch Pour, Open Cup. The cost for these classes includes all art materials along with small refreshments each night.
